Tissue repair using allogeneic dermal fibroblasts
First Claim
1. A method for the augmentation of subcutaneous or dermal tissue in a subject, which method comprises the steps of:
- (i) providing a suspension comprising allogeneic dermal fibroblasts in a preservation medium having a pH of about 7.6, an osmolality of about 360 and comprising the following components;
6-hydroxy-2,5,7,8-tetramethylchromane-2-carboxylic acid, Na+, K+, Ca2+, Mg2+, Cl−
, H2PO4−
, HCO3−
, HEPES, Lactobionate, Sucrose, Mannitol, Glucose, Dextran-40, Adenosine and Glutathione; and
(ii) injecting an effective volume of the suspension into tissue subadjacent to the subcutaneous or dermal tissue so that the tissue is augmented.

Abstract
The present invention provides a method for the repair of subcutaneous or dermal tissue in a subject, comprising in one aspect the injection of a suspension of allogeneic dermal fibroblasts into the subject. By injecting a suspension of allogeneic cells, the invention provides, for example, long-term augmentation of the subadjacent tissue without the disadvantages that accompany the preparation and/or use of presently available materials such as autologous fibroblasts cells or collagen.
According to a first aspect of the invention there is provided a method for the augmentation of subcutaneous or dermal tissue in a subject, which method comprises the steps of:
- (i) providing a suspension of allogeneic dermal fibroblasts; and
- (ii) injecting an effective volume of the suspension into tissue subadjacent to the subcutaneous or dermal tissue so that the tissue is augmented.
The method is preferably cosmetic.
